一、原因
nginx默认限制上传上线1M
二、解决方案
很简单,只需要修改一下nginx.conf配置文件。在http/server/location三处中任意一处添加client_max_body_size 50m;
随后重启nginx服务即可!
server {
listen 443 ssl;
server_name localhost;
ssl_certificate openssl/server.crt;
ssl_certificate_key openssl/server.key;
ssl_session_cache shared:SSL:1m;
ssl_session_timeout 5m;
ssl_ciphers HIGH:!aNULL:!MD5;
ssl_prefer_server_ciphers on;
location / {
proxy_pass http://127.0.0.1:82/;
client_max_body_size 50m;
fastcgi_ignore_client_abort on;
proxy_store off;
proxy_redirect off;
proxy_ignore_client_abort on;
proxy_connect_timeout 300s;
proxy_read_timeout 300s;
proxy_send_timeout 300s;
proxy_next_upstream http_502 http_504 http_404 error timeout invalid_header;
proxy_set_header Host $host;
proxy_set_header REMOTE_ADDR $remote_addr;
proxy_set_header REMOTE-HOST $remote_addr;
proxy_set_header HTTP_X_FORWARDED_FOR $remote_addr;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}
}